1DescriptionNVD
Possible out of bound memory access due to improper boundary check while creating HSYNC fence in Snapdragon Auto, Snapdragon Connectivity, Snapdragon Consumer IOT, Snapdragon Industrial IOT, Snapdragon Mobile, Snapdragon Wearables

Technical ContextAI
This vulnerability is classified as Buffer Overflow (CWE-119), which allows attackers to corrupt memory to execute arbitrary code or crash the application. Possible out of bound memory access due to improper boundary check while creating HSYNC fence in Snapdragon Auto, Snapdragon Connectivity, Snapdragon Consumer IOT, Snapdragon Industrial IOT, Snapdragon Mobile, Snapdragon Wearables Affected products include: Qualcomm Ar8031 Firmware, Qualcomm Csra6620 Firmware, Qualcomm Csra6640 Firmware, Qualcomm Fsm10055 Firmware, Qualcomm Fsm10056 Firmware.
